I just tested it with a Huawei E8372.

With my iPhone I get a little cell phone logo on the monitoring screen (Upper right of the box for the Online / Offline) and and IP address that I can toggle back and forth from.

With the LTE stick I get nothing. The stick powers up and connects to the network but the Web Presenter doesn't see it as a valid network source.

Web Presenter UltraHD firmware v. 3.2

It's been a while since I set one up but the 8372 works in a couple of modes.

Either as a USB Powered WiFi access point for its 4G modem. In this mode it doesn't pass data over USB.

Or in direct USB mode.

I'm fairly sure you might need to make sure it's not in access point mode to have it work as a direct 4G USB dongle.
